Transaction f8eddfbddab009a65b2b74db2b15afc607bd35185b27f9bde62ee0e765b19863
1 Input
1 Output
-
f8eddfbddab009a65b2b74db2b15afc607bd35185b27f9bde62ee0e765b19863:0
- value
- 1369763
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4239417e5abfb9856110d107466f567bd2675ea9 OP_EQUAL
- address
- 37jB7QiNzFRQ71dLjBSKLVH4TQeUE32Sdc